Parineeti Chopra Falls Sick

Bubbly and vivacious Bollywood actress Parineeti Chopra says she is not so “happy” as she is not feeling well.
 
“Sick and lying in bed. Not not not happyy,” Parineeti tweeted on Saturday. 
 
However, the actress, who made her acting debut with a supporting role in the 2011 romantic comedy "Ladies vs Ricky Bahl", refrained from sharing more information about her illness on the social media platform. 
 
Meanwhile, 2014 turned out to be a low key year for the cousin of actress Priyanka Chopra. Of Parineeti's three releases -- "Hasee Toh Phasee", "Daawat-e-Ishq" and "Kill Dil", two bombed at the box office.
 
"Hasee Toh Phasee", which also starred Sidharth Malhotra, had a fair box office performance.
